Informix to Report Unexpected Profit

Informix Corp. said will report a profit for the fourth quarter--surprising Wall Street expectations of a loss--on stronger sales of its database software products. The Menlo Park-based company, which has been struggling for the last year amid marketing missteps and management turmoil, also said it expects results to continue improving in coming quarters. After the market closed, the company released preliminary figures for the fourth quarter. It said it expects to report net income of $9.2 million, or 5 cents a share on a diluted basis. A comparison with last year’s results was not immediately available because the company is restating its results for the last few quarters because of accounting errors. Wall Street had been expecting Informix to report a loss of 16 cents a share. Informix shares rose 22 cents to $7.38 on Nasdaq.
